The cheapest way to get from Finglas to Shankill is to drive which costs €3 - €6 and takes 27 min.
The fastest way to get from Finglas to Shankill is to taxi which takes 27 min and costs €35 - €45.
No, there is no direct bus from Finglas to Shankill. However, there are services departing from Finglas Place and arriving at Stonebridge Close via Nassau Street.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 24m.
No, there is no direct train from Finglas to Shankill. However, there are services departing from Broombridge and arriving at Shankill via Dublin Connolly.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 1m.
The distance between Finglas and Shankill is 24 km. The road distance is 23.2 km.
The best way to get from Finglas to Shankill without a car is to train which takes 1h 1m and costs €4 - €8.
It takes approximately 1h 1m to get from Finglas to Shankill, including transfers.
Finglas to Shankill bus services, operated by Dublin Bus, depart from Finglas Place station.
Finglas to Shankill train services, operated by Iarnród Éireann (Irish Rail), depart from Broombridge station.
The best way to get from Finglas to Shankill is to train which takes 1h 1m and costs €4 - €8.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s €6 and takes 1h 24m.
